Analysis
Honduras recorded 1.57 for temperature change with respect to a baseline climatology in 2024.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 6.4% on the previous year and up 151.8% over ten years.
Over the whole period, temperature change with respect to a baseline climatology in Honduras peaked at 1.67 in 2020 and was at its lowest, -0.322, in 1967.
Honduras ranks 153rd of 225 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| -0.0981 | -0.322 | 0.231 | 9 |
| 1970s | 0.14 | -0.239 | 0.518 | 10 |
| 1980s | 0.3718 | 0.154 | 0.675 | 10 |
| 1990s | 0.5632 | 0.119 | 1.08 | 10 |
| 2000s | 0.5438 | 0.011 | 0.851 | 10 |
| 2010s | 0.8645 | 0.565 | 1.25 | 10 |
| 2020s | 1.32 | 0.808 | 1.67 | 5 |
